    Well I forgot my entire handbag today. Good to know I don’t feel quite so tethered to it, I guess. So that meant no spend. I really didn’t factor in the school holidays though.

    I came home from work to an extra child for the night which meant changing up dinner to a meal that would fill the stomachs of teen boys that had been out biking all day so Mac and Cheese it was.

    Thought i’d throw a cake together for snack and morning tea for tomorrow and got half. way through it only to discover said teens had used all the eggs. So off I sent them to the supermarket with $10 and the don’t buy anything else spiel. Well they came back with the smallest pack of eggs ever and a bottle of soda water. Oh well. $7.50 spent.

    This is going to be so much harder than I thought. I spent some time today browsing the supermarket sites and man NZ food prices are horrendous. I know we are in desperate need of butter but $8.29 was the cheapest 500g block I could find. So we will be using it very sparingly from now on.

    Feel free to through suggestions on butter alternatives at me. For now I’m just using up the very large container of coconut oil I found in the pantry.

    Day One of 365 saw me spend $4 on a loaf of bread. I managed to throw together a bento bowl using what we already had at home. In my rush I had grabbed chicken thigh fillets with the bone in for the meal so I got to work deboning the chicken so we could use it, thank goodness there was only one bone in each.

    The dogs sure were happy to munch away on the raw chicken bones. I looked at the price of these only and was shocked to see that buying the thigh this was is $10 cheaper per kilogram so for the extra few minutes we will definitely be doing this again.

    Crunchy coating was made using a Skinny Mixers recipe- I had no idea I actually had tapioca flour in the cupboard. I can’t recall the recipe it was purchased for either. It will be good to use up some of the stored items that we have. Not sure what will happen after that?

    One child was away for the night so there was plenty of chicken left over for todays sandwiches.
